Department of Management
The Department of Management at Chirchiq State Pedagogical University, established in 2022, focuses on training competitive specialists in educational institution management. It conducts research on modern management methodologies and offers various academic programs in management and school administration.
DEPARTMENT OF MANAGEMENT
Year of Establishment: 2022 Address: Chirchiq city, Amir Temur street, 104, Main building, 4th floor, room 407. The Department of Management separated from the "Pedagogy and Management" department on July 29, 2022, in accordance with Decision No. 19 of the Council of Chirchiq State Pedagogical University.
AIMS AND OBJECTIVES OF THE DEPARTMENT Department's Mission: To train specialized personnel for institutions of the continuous education system of the Republic.
Our Goal:
- To train competitive specialized personnel in the field of "Educational Institution Management" and guide them into practice.

SCIENTIFIC-RESEARCH DIRECTIONS AND PROJECTS The Department of Management is conducting research in several strategic directions in its scientific-research activities. The following directions aim to conduct scientific research that meets modern educational requirements, expand cooperation with the national and international scientific community, and achieve practical results:
- Research on Technologies for Developing Management Skills in Management Students: Developing management teaching methodology is one of the priority areas of the department. This includes methodologies for developing students' management competencies in the context of an educational cluster (e.g., School Management) (D.A. Sultanova), and mechanisms for developing students' management competencies during the modernization of the higher education system (A. Rasulov).
- Research on Methodologies for Developing Students' Economic Knowledge: The department's scientific research in this area is focused on studying national and international literary heritage. This includes improving the methodology of teaching "Fundamentals of Entrepreneurship" based on innovative technologies (K. Khurramov). Scientific research on "Methodology for developing students' frugality skills based on the philosophical views of great thinkers" (A. Suyarov) has also been launched.
- Research on Technologies for Developing Management Competencies Based on Students' Individual Learning Trajectory: This includes improving person-centered education methodology in increasing the prestige of modern teachers in the context of an educational cluster (I. Khakimova), technologies for developing higher education students' readiness for professional activity based on a competency approach (I. Yunusova), and methodology for developing innovative pedagogical activity of general education school teachers based on an individual approach (G. Tirkasheva). Individual learning is considered one of the most effective technologies in realizing a student's personal potential in the field of education.
- Project Design Technologies in Improving Management Teaching Methodology: Research aimed at forming students' management and communication skills has been a key priority of the department. (D. Sultanova, I. Khakimova, K. Khurramov, A. Suyarov, B. Rustamov). These directions serve to enhance the department's scientific-research potential and develop new modern methodologies.
